6 Things To Keep in Mind While Renovating Your Bathroom

You don’t need so many resources in relatively more quantity to get anything done for the first time or even buying something new- like a house, a car or for that matter anything new. But right-sizing and upgrading is something which requires a lot of attention, money, supervision and time. All these resources are engaged while upgrading an old thing is because of the sheer fact that you need to take care of the old systems on which that thing is based on.


The best example of an upgrade is a renovation. Renovating your house or a part of it, say a Bathroom is a tedious job and you need to take care of certain things while doing that. We have enlisted 6 important things that you should keep in mind while you renovate your bathroom to upgrade it to a modern bathroom:

       1. New Pipework- 

      First things first. Just like an old body has old bones, an old bathroom has an old pipework and pipework is as important as bones. Over the years the sediments reduce the pressure in the pipes and also does a lot of wear and tear to them. It is time to get a new pipework altogether to avoid any future damages.

2. Good quality products- 

      The very first thing that strikes us on the very thought of renovating a bathroom is the cost and obviously cost matters a lot. Although if you are planning to renovate your bathroom do not try to save a lot of cost by compromising on the quality of the products. Well, it doesn’t mean you should splurge either.

3. Civil work agency- 

     Another way by which people try to cut cost is hiring a plumber to do the renovation work. Well, there is a difference between a plumber and a professional who does the civil work. A plumber is a guy who fixes the dripping faucets and other leakages, on the other hand, a civil work guy knows in and out of the whole structure, pipework, material to be used etc. Always hire a specialist.

4. Don’t go overboard with spending- 

      Renovation might make a few people splurge. Splurging swells the budget and one might end up burning a big hole in the pocket. This can affect the other plans too. Well, you need to consider the return on investment before you plan on the spending for the renovation.

5. Don’t Do it Yourself- 

      Some people may go too far with taking matters into their own hands. Certain things like fixing water leaks are pursued and are done through self-diagnosis by getting waterproofing stuff from hardware stores. Well, if you a mason yourself or have a substantial experience, only then try this, otherwise, you might end up paying a fortune for fixing the eventual damage.

6. Concealed water cisterns and Wall Mounting seats- 

     This time you have to upgrade well and do that you should go with concealed water cisterns. The concealed cisterns are not only modern but also save a lot of space as their predecessors were Wall mounting, they occupied a lot of space on the wall. Similarly, you could save space with toilet seats too. Go with wall mounting seats which would save a lot of space on the ground.

Considering these tips, it would be easier to renovate your bathrooms.
